[QUOTE="talien, post: 5449241, member: 3285"] [b]The Windthrope Legacy: Part 3 – Who Ya Gonna Call?[/b] There was an international phone number that Hammer had with him at all times. As cell leader he had never needed to use it. Now was as good a time as any. He dialed the number. It pinged an automated system. Hammer pressed one for an operator and was put on hold with some lovely country tunes and the occasional “Your call is important to us, please stay on the line.” He was finally rewarded with a human voice. “Hi, this is Nancy in customer service. How can I help you?” "Nancy, this is Agent Hammer. I need an extraction." "Please hold while I transfer you to Special Claims.” He was put on hold again. Hammer's anxiety increased with each passing minute. Two minutes later, a male voice picked up. "This is Special Claims." "This is Agent Hammer. I am asking for extraction for my team." There was an odd clicking on the phone. “Your claims will be looked into. Please provide a phone number and an address where we can reach you.” Hammer hung up and threw the phone in a trash bin. "Any luck?" asked Guppy, arms loaded with some basic electronics. Hammer shook his head. "Your trace detector worked. They were trying to track us." Guppy looked crestfallen. "First time I've been sorry a gadget of mine worked." [/QUOTE]
